Meet Emmy Raine Curtis

– Country of origin: Canada

– Current position and company: Sports Content Creator & Reporter on TikTok

Founder of Girls at the Games 

Social Media Coordinator at The GIST

– Education: H. Bachelor of Arts in Journalism, University of Toronto

Grad Certificate in Contemporary Journalism, Centennial College

Certificate in Reconciliation Education, First Nations University of Canada

Certificate in International Relations, SUNY Plattsburgh

Certificate in Content Creation, TikTok Online University

– Work experience: A Media Operations team leader at Al Thumama Stadium during the 2022 FIFA World Cup in Qatar at age 19

Digital Host and Content Creator for TikTok x FIFA during the 2023 FIFA Women’s World Cup in Australia

Founder of Girls at the Games, a fast-growing platform amplifying and empowering women in sports, with a focus on community-building in Vancouver and beyond

Created branded content for global sports and lifestyle brands including DoorDash, Mas+ by Messi, Powerade, Always, and more.

– Professional achievements: Built a personal brand of 45K+ followers on TikTok (@itsemraine) by documenting the behind-the-scenes of working in sports

Produced a TikTok ad for FIFA Women’s World Cup 2023 that earned over 13 million views

Featured as one of 12 “Women in Sports “Game Changers” alongside names like Angel Reese, Coco Gruff, and more.

Speaker, mentor, and media contributor spotlighting women’s roles in the sports industry

– Why do you work in sports/ what brought you into the industry: I’ve been a die-hard sports fan my whole life, but growing up, I didn’t see many people who looked like me on the sidelines or in the press box. I got into this industry to change that, to create content, coverage, and conversations that reflect the real community behind the game. Storytelling is my way of helping fans feel seen and inspired.

 What would you like to contribute to or change in the sports industry: I want to help build a sports culture that celebrates everyone,  athletes, fans, creators, and workers who bring the magic of sport to life. My goal is to expand visibility for women and marginalized voices in sports media.
